Output 1fa0e176314fa1a71fa14e6a75fa9f36fe573ff9131f2cc16b2f88e4e971252d:0

value
393544
script pubkey
OP_0 OP_PUSHBYTES_20 d15eb2f2bb39ad657be5440cbe540d689bcb07e6
address
bc1q690t9u4m8xkk27l9gsxtu4qddzdukplxj0axt5
transaction
1fa0e176314fa1a71fa14e6a75fa9f36fe573ff9131f2cc16b2f88e4e971252d
confirmations
18320
spent
true